[publican-list] [Bug 554261] New: Publican not generating correct POTs from English XML files

bugzilla at redhat.com bugzilla at redhat.com
Mon Jan 11 06:56:15 UTC 2010


Please do not reply directly to this email. All additional
comments should be made in the comments box of this bug.

Summary: Publican not generating correct POTs from English XML files

https://bugzilla.redhat.com/show_bug.cgi?id=554261

           Summary: Publican not generating correct POTs from English XML
                    files
           Product: Red Hat Enterprise Linux 5
           Version: 5.4
          Platform: All
        OS/Version: Linux
            Status: NEW
          Severity: medium
          Priority: low
         Component: publican
        AssignedTo: mhideo at redhat.com
        ReportedBy: ankit at redhat.com
         QAContact: jwulf at redhat.com
                CC: publican-list at redhat.com
    Classification: Red Hat
    Target Release: ---


Description of problem:

I have checked out Installation Guide for RHEL6 (from
https://svn.devel.redhat.com/repos/ecs/Red_Hat_Enterprise_Linux/6.0/Installation_Guide)
and tried to update the pot with "publican update_pot" command. It did create
POT files, but noticed that there are many files with no messages for
translation while there are messages in English XML files for it. 

e.g. compare below
* POT file -
https://svn.devel.redhat.com/repos/ecs/Red_Hat_Enterprise_Linux/6.0/Installation_Guide/pot/X86_Uninstall-Windows-bootloader-para-1.pot
* English file -
https://svn.devel.redhat.com/repos/ecs/Red_Hat_Enterprise_Linux/6.0/Installation_Guide/en-US/X86_Uninstall-Windows-bootloader-para-1.xml

* POT file -
https://svn.devel.redhat.com/repos/ecs/Red_Hat_Enterprise_Linux/6.0/Installation_Guide/pot/X86_Uninstall-Windows-bootloader-para-2.pot
* English file -
https://svn.devel.redhat.com/repos/ecs/Red_Hat_Enterprise_Linux/6.0/Installation_Guide/en-US/X86_Uninstall-Windows-bootloader-para-2.xml

* POT file -
https://svn.devel.redhat.com/repos/ecs/Red_Hat_Enterprise_Linux/6.0/Installation_Guide/pot/X86_Uninstall-Windows-bootloader-para-3.pot
* English file -
https://svn.devel.redhat.com/repos/ecs/Red_Hat_Enterprise_Linux/6.0/Installation_Guide/en-US/X86_Uninstall-Windows-bootloader-para-3.xml

There is a long list of such files.

Version-Release number of selected component (if applicable):
[ankit at ankit Installation_Guide]$ publican -v
version=1.3
[ankit at ankit Installation_Guide]$ rpm -q publican
publican-1.3-0.el5
[ankit at ankit Installation_Guide]$ cat /etc/redhat-release 
Red Hat Enterprise Linux Client release 5.4 (Tikanga)
[ankit at ankit Installation_Guide]$ 


How reproducible:
Everytime

Steps to Reproduce:
1. Check out RHEL6 Installation Guide
2. Run "publican update_pot"
3. And observe the POT files

Actual results:
You will notice many of the POT files have no message marked for translation

Expected results:
POT file should have messages for translation

Additional info:

-- 
Configure bugmail: https://bugzilla.redhat.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.




More information about the publican-list mailing list